I recently re-read a couple of the original bond books and they are still excellent. I know a lot have been written by other authors and I was wondering if anyone could give me a recommendation (or otherwise...) for any of them?

The only one I've read is the Sebastian Faulks effort, which I thought was fairly awful.

To update this thread, I've now read a couple. Colonel Sun was very good - thanks for the recommendation. Carte Blanche, Deavers effort, was not. Only read it because it was available and wish I'd not bothered. Didn't feel like a Bond book and was generally terrible into the bargain. The new one, Solo, is in my pile to read soon.
